Output 54ddbdccce2c7249250abc993b49fe590957a3e1ee4b760df44dc1d61729471f:6

value
6103666
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e58a9f1649737e56f2fdf5353404aa4fe9be009a OP_EQUALVERIFY OP_CHECKSIG
address
1MvhoWtGiKLoHuah5Dh1yarQP161YWzzH2
transaction
54ddbdccce2c7249250abc993b49fe590957a3e1ee4b760df44dc1d61729471f
spent
true